Bistro (Formerly Cleopatra's) – Popular Cyclists' Café

Highlight • Cafe

Very popular café serving drinks, snacks and light meals including pizza.
Cycle friendly and often buzzing with cyclists.
Open Mon to Thurs 9:30 - 17:00.
Fri and Sat 9:30 - 18:00
Sun 9:30 - 16:00

Queens Park Bridge

Highlight • Viewpoint

You may well need to dismount if busy, but a good way of getting across the River Dee in Chester whilst avoiding the worst of the traffic and providing a more scenic route.
